diff --git a/readme.md b/readme.md index c6e6f09..efaa312 100644 --- a/readme.md +++ b/readme.md @@ -15,6 +15,8 @@ - [3_1_adc128传感器读值为0](#3_1_adc128传感器读值为0) - [3_2_脚本执行时出现大批量语法错误](#3_2_脚本执行时出现大批量语法错误) - [4_附属工具](#4_附属工具) + - [4_1_fruparse](#4_1_fruparse) +- [5_关于nicsensor_v2](#5_关于nicsensor_v2) ## 1_简介 @@ -118,6 +120,13 @@ nicsensor工具是在带有i2ctool工具(i2ctransfer、i2cdetect)的BMC下用于 ### 2_5_调试模式使用 +> 关联变量 `DEBUG_MODE`, 启用调试模式时需要将该变量的值配置为1 + +如果不需要借助脚本来选通服务器上对应的channel, 仅需要做传感器数值测试, 可以启用调试模式。 +在调试模式下, 脚本不会执行选通PCA9641以及PCA9546/9548的操作。仅直接测试传感器。因此,需要手动调整两个变量 +- `DEBUG_MODE` +- `i2c_bus` + ## 3_常见问题 ### 3_1_ADC128传感器读值为0 @@ -128,4 +137,13 @@ ADC128传感器在使用时需要初始化, 因此第一次读取时传感器可 通常是因为服务器上含有PCA9641切断了BMC的I2C控制权导致,重试即可 -## 4_附属工具 \ No newline at end of file +## 4_附属工具 + +### 4_1_FruParse +提供了一个简单python脚本用于解析FRU的数据, 将nicsensor读取到的FRU数据拷贝到frudata.txt后, 执行 +`python fru_parse.py`即可将读取到的数据转化为FRU内容 + +## 5_关于nicsensor_v2 + +nicsensor_v2将服务器选通channel和读取传感器数值的功能解耦,因此在单独使用某个功能时可以直接找到对应的脚本进行测试。 +详见[nicsensor_v2](./nicsensor_v2/readme.md) \ No newline at end of file